Hey guys,
So it’s cold and very windy out today so time to see if this could stand proper Canadian winter weatherIn this climate I could go with my warmest Canada Goose parka and a t-shirt and be toasty. Or go with my less warm / lighter Canada goose parka and a thermal and be good as well.
The weight of the N1 is about the same as the lighter (navy) parka. But obviously not nearly as baggy.
So I wore my Uniqlo ultra warm long sleeved T-shirt underneath and went with Mrs Chibs to walk the dog.
Once I buttoned up the collar, I was completely fine! About as warm as I would want. It was really windy (that feels like -21 with wind chill was pretty accurate) and my wife was complaining the she could feel it through her Canada Goode parka. Not through my N1 though. I don’t know if it’s that extra layer Ironheart puts to block wind or the fact that this N1 is oiled (or both?) but it works very well! If it were much colder I’d probably throw on an other layer and be totally fine still.
I wavered between a medium and large some more (after that last post) but decided to stick with Large. I like the extra room I can use for layering and not totally sure but feel the medium would be a bit too snug in certain areas. Not sure I’d even be able to button that collar up around my neck because the Large just fits in this regard.
An other win from Iron Heart. My only regret was not getting direct from Ironheart at the beginning of the season. This is an awesome winter jacket!!

@krs1 , the N1's are normally sized generous, so you might get away with a Medium. I would always recommend to measure a jacket that fits you well the way IH does and compare those measurements with the published sizing chart.
Fwiw, i sized down one , still being able to layer a UHF with a trim fit. -
